Key Responsibilities of an Assistant General Manager in PDC Banks

The key responsibilities of an Assistant General Manager in PDC Banks include:

  • Managing risk: The Assistant General Manager is responsible for identifying and mitigating risks to the bank, including credit risk, market risk, and operational risk.
  • Ensuring compliance: The Assistant General Manager must ensure that the bank is compliant with all relevant laws and regulations, including those related to anti-money laundering and know-your-customer requirements.
  • Developing business plans: The Assistant General Manager is responsible for developing and implementing business plans to achieve the bank's strategic objectives.
  • Maintaining relationships: The Assistant General Manager must maintain relationships with stakeholders, including customers, employees, and regulators.

Skills and Qualifications Required

To be a successful Assistant General Manager in PDC Banks, an individual must possess a range of skills and qualifications, including:

  • Strong leadership and management skills: The ability to lead and manage teams, as well as to motivate and develop employees.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ills: The ability to communicate effectively with stakeholders, including customers, employees, and regulators.
  • Strong problem-solving and analytical skills: The ability to analyze complex problems and develop effective solutions.
  • Knowledge of banking regulations and financial management: A strong understanding of banking regulations, including those related to risk management and compliance, as well as knowledge of financial management principles and practices.
